This seems so pertinent when you translate it to the black experience in America.   For centuries a system of racism and white supremacy has dominated the sociopolitical and economic system of America.  The barbaric violent system of slavery, and Jim Crow allowed white supremacists and their descendants to accumulate, and amass vast amounts of wealth and power for free, or pennies on the dollar.  This imbalance of power resulted in the transfer of generational wealth and inheritance for the families, and friends of those in power.  Moreover, even if you were not a slave owner, or even a racist, the system was engineered in way that just because you had white skin you were afforded the privileges, benefits, advantages, and accoutrements of a free society.

When African Americans were “freed” from slavery, that removed all free labor assets, and we became a liability to the system.  We were now considered competitors for resources, because our food was no longer rationed, our domain was not a plantation shack, our bodies were no longer a free count for state representatives, and the poor working class whites had to compete.

Time progressed from decades to centuries,  we deserved more rights, inclusion, representation, education, and to declare our inherent independent sovereign human rights that are divinely granted to mankind, and not just whites. However, this was considered a threat, and this resulted in vagrancy laws, night riders, Klan raids, nationwide lynching’s, voting restrictions, Eugenics programs, separate and unequal social programs, and etc.
